Just be sure you use your index and thumb as a lever for the stick, and keep the other three fingers loose to allow the stick to bounce, this not only helps with rebound, playin fast, being able to roll, and lastly prevent carpel tunnel by not allowing the majority of the shock to enter your wrist.
